具有自校核功能的配电网调度方法

摘  要:为了提高配电网运行效率,及时发现配电网中异常数据信息,设计一种新型的配电网调度方案。该方案硬件包括调度控制中心、监控中心、调度计算等模块,能够向不同的区域提供配电网电力资源,并保证电力设备安全。该方法还采用ARM系列的LPC2214微处理器和DSP数据处理器,实现配电网不同区域信息的校核与调度;在进行调度数据信息时,通过聚类算法对不同异常信息类型进行分类,提高校核能力;又通过算法模型对不同调度数据信息进行评估,提高数据评估能力。通过试验,该方法大大提高了配电网调度能力,数据分析准确度高。In order to improve the operation efficiency of the distribution network and discover abnormal data in the distribution network in time,a new type of distribution network dispatching plan is designed.The plan includes dispatching control center,monitoring center,dispatching calculation module,etc.Different areas provide power resources for the distribution network and ensure the safety of power equipment.The method also uses the LPC2214 microprocessor and DSP data processor of the ARM series to realize the verification and scheduling of information in different areas of the distribution network.In scheduling data information,the clustering algorithm is used to classify different abnormal information types to improve.In order to verify the ability,the algorithm model is used to evaluate different scheduling data information,and improve data evaluatonal capability.Through experiments,this research method has greatly improved the dispatching ability of the distribution network,and the accuracy of data analysis is high.

关 键 词:配电网 异常数据 电网调度 聚类分析
